Country-specific Guidelines

Applying for an eVisa from Singapore can vary by destination. Each country has its own specific requirements and processes. Understanding these differences is key. This guide helps you navigate through various country guidelines. Read on to learn about the specific requirements for popular destinations.

Australia Evisa Guidelines

Singapore citizens need an Electronic Travel Authority (ETA) for Australia. This eVisa allows short-term visits. You must provide a valid passport. The passport should have at least six months’ validity. Ensure you have a valid email address to receive updates. The application process is straightforward and quick.

India Evisa Guidelines

India offers an eVisa for tourism, business, or medical visits. You need a passport-sized photo and a scanned copy of your passport. The passport must be valid for at least six months. Fill in the online application form carefully. Incorrect details can lead to rejection. Processing time usually takes a few days.

United States Evisa Guidelines

Singaporeans must apply for the ESTA to visit the U.S. This eVisa is valid for short stays. You must have an e-passport. The application asks for personal and travel information. Make sure all details are accurate. Approval usually takes a few minutes. Check the status online before traveling.

United Kingdom Evisa Guidelines

For the UK, Singaporeans should apply for a Standard Visitor Visa. This visa covers tourism and short business trips. You need a passport with six months’ validity. Financial proof for your trip is required. The online form requires detailed information. Processing can take up to three weeks, so plan ahead.

Canada Evisa Guidelines

Singaporeans require an Electronic Travel Authorization (eTA) for Canada. This eVisa is linked to your passport. Ensure your passport is valid during your stay. The application is simple, requiring basic personal details. Approval is usually instant. Check your email for confirmation.

Understanding Local Customs

Every country has its own set of customs that may surprise you. In some Asian countries, for example, removing your shoes before entering a home is a common practice. This simple gesture shows respect for your host’s space. In contrast, when visiting the Middle East, you might notice people using their right hand for eating and greeting, as the left hand is considered unclean. Such insights can help you interact politely and avoid awkward situations. ###

Respecting Dress Codes

Dress codes vary significantly from one culture to another. In many conservative societies, dressing modestly is not just a suggestion but a requirement. As a traveler, adhering to local dress codes shows respect. Imagine visiting a temple or mosque and being denied entry because of inappropriate attire. Packing clothes that cover your shoulders and knees can prevent this issue and show that you value local traditions. ###

Mindful Communication

Communication isn’t just about language; it’s also about gestures and expressions. In Japan, for instance, it’s common to bow as a greeting rather than shaking hands. This simple act can go a long way in showing respect. Meanwhile, in some cultures, direct eye contact can be perceived as confrontational. Observing and adapting to these communication styles will help you connect better with locals and enhance your travel experience. ###

Gift-giving Etiquette

Gift-giving can be an important part of cultural etiquette. In some places, refusing a gift might be seen as rude, while in others, accepting it immediately could be considered greedy. Researching these customs before your trip can be beneficial. For example, in China, gifts are often refused initially before being accepted. Such knowledge can help you navigate social situations gracefully. ###

Dining Etiquette

Dining customs can vary widely. In India, eating with your hands is a common practice, while in Europe, using cutlery is the norm. Understanding these differences can enhance your dining experience.
